Product Description
NexPrene® 9065A BK LCOF thermoplastic vulcanizate is a fully crosslinked, EPDM/PP compound. It is designed to replace thermoset elastomers, such as EPDM or polychloroprene, and traditional thermoplastic TPVs. NexPrene® 9065A BK LCOF provides the performance of vulcanized rubber with the advantage of low-cost thermoplastic processing.

Applications:
Suitable for automotive sealing applications requiring flexibility and resiliency with low coefficient of friction properties.
